India: Cochin Shipyard Receives MOU Excellence Award

Business & Finance

 

Cochin Shipyard Ltd received the MOU Excellence Award for the year 2009-10 for its outstanding performance under the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) entered into with the Government of India. The award was presented by the Hon’ble Prime Minister of India, Dr Manmohan Singh to Cmde K Subramaniam, CMD at a function held at Vigyan Bhavan, New Delhi on 31 January 2012.

This is the third consecutive year that the Company has received this prestigious Award.

The growth of CSL has been phenomenal in the last 5 years. The income of the Company increased from Rs 846 Crores in 2006-07 to Rs 1603 Crores in 2010-2011 and net profit increased from Rs 58 Crores to Rs 228 crores. During the same period, the company has received excellent rating consecutively in the last 4 years for its performance under the MOU with Government of India. In recognition of its performance, CSL was awarded the Category 1 Miniratna Status by Government of India in July 2008.
